**Ticket DSP-902: dispatch heuristic auth failure**

The Routewick driver-assignment heuristic stopped scoring candidates at 03:10 — its credential for the Lanegrid proximity service expired. Assignments fell back to round-robin; ETAs degraded in the Varnmouth region. Rotated the service account, heuristic back online. Update the secret in the dispatch-worker config before next deploy. Replacement key follows.

API key for kahop-bagef: zpat2_yb

// Seat-map renderer for the Gilded Lark Theatre frontend.
// Heads up for release: these knobs control zoom steps, seat glyph
// sizing, and the row-label fade threshold. QA signs off against
// these exact values, so bump them only with a changelog entry.
// The current render constants are:

tuning constants:
BUDGETS = {
    "druath": 240,
    "lamwyn": 180,
    "silael": 275,
}

Subject: Welcome to the Glasswing on-call rotation

Hi, and welcome aboard. As the new on-call, you'll mostly interact with Glasswing, our audit-log viewer, when investigating access alerts. It's read-only, so you can't break anything by clicking around. Most pages resolve to either a stale index (re-run the sweep job) or a permissions mismatch (escalate to the Farrow team). The triage checklist, common queries, and escalation contacts are all kept on the internal page here.

dashboard of kafop-yagep = https://jira.zemvarsys.internal/pages/pages/pages/display/cc87

Management Meeting Minutes — Orvane Launch Plan

Present: heads of Product, Marketing, Operations, and Support. The Orvane platform launch is confirmed for the first week of the spring quarter. Marketing will finalize collateral two weeks prior; Operations confirmed warehouse readiness in Delmont and Carrow. Support staffing increases by six roles before launch. Pricing tiers were reviewed and locked. Each department head submits a readiness checklist by Friday. The underlying strategic context is recorded below.

confidential, kagep-kahof: Druokax Systems plans to lower the Ulaath list price by 53 percent in March.